The Kolcraft Cloud Plus is an inexpensive and light stroller, but it doesn't feel cheap or fragile. It has an ample storage basket and a single-hand fold. And if you do happen to bump into an issue with your stroller, the brand's customer service is ideal for free tune-ups as well as repairs.

The Summer Infant 3D Mini is another stroller that's extremely light and has attractive features, like two cup holders in the parent tray and a decently sized canopy. It's also available in a variety of different colors. If you're seeking a stroller slightly more robust consider the Baby Jogger City Mini GT All-Terrain stroller. It's not just cheaper than the traditional full-size strollers, but also has all the bells and whistles found in more expensive models, like the deep recline, adjustable leg rests, an adjustable width for doors, and more.

When it comes to double strollers the Graco Expedition Double checks a lot of boxes for the price. It's an excellent option for urban and suburban parents with multiple children who want a smooth ride, similar seat padding and design, and plenty of extra features, including tray for parents and storage in the seat. It's not equipped with the most expensive features, like suspension and tracking, but it's much more affordable than other double strollers.

The Kolcraft Cloud Plus stroller is an excellent choice for families with a tight budget that don't want to sacrifice features. The lightweight stroller has one-handed folding that can fit into overhead bins. It also has a spacious basket under the carriage, parent cup holders as well as an eating tray. While it's not as pretty as some of the other strollers we've tested, it is a lot cheaper and has many of the same features as more expensive models.

The Cloud Plus is not only affordable, but also has a stylish design. It features an extremely durable frame that can endure a lot of usage and has a brake that you can operate with one hand. It can easily push on flat surfaces and can overcome obstacles such as curbs and a few other ones easily, but it doesn't have the same stance as some of the larger strollers we evaluated, which may make it harder to navigate on uneven surfaces. It does not have a deep recline, and the sun canopy is a bit too short, but those are small sacrifices to make for such an affordable price.

The Doona Combo can be a great option for families on a tight budget who don't need to spend a lot of money but still need a stroller. This specialty product is both a car seat and a stroller and folds up with the seat attached which makes it a compact, convenient option for those who travel or use public transport. This stroller's only downside is that it didn't have nearly as many features for parents as well as children as the other models we evaluated. This affected its score for ease-of-use.

A stroller is an important purchase for any parent. It is important to think about how many children you have, the age they are, and if they require car seats. Also, you should consider the features you'd like in strollers, such as storage space and mobility. You might consider the weight and portability of the stroller.
